Had A Long Flight. Went For Usual Walk. Came Back And Dropped Dead. Reason Behind Death?
my father dropped dead two days after a long flight from Greece. he went for his usual walk and came back and ten minutes later said he did not feel good and dropped to the ground. I think he was dead once he fell to the floor. how does someone just die like that? we did not do an autopsy ,but regret it now. He was 59 he was going to be 60 two weeks after his death. he went to a cardiologist a year before for certain heart palpatations he used to get. They did not see anything bad they told him his heart was strong. please can anyone give us any answers.
There are many causes of sudden death. The preceding history of long flight can have an association with sudden death. However, the underlying disease is something else which is aggravated by some precipitating factor. A long distance flight can be that precipitating factor. Sudden death can occur in situations like myocardial infarction, stroke, pulmonary embolism, subdural hemorrhage, etc. Was there any history of cardiovascular disease in past? An autopsy can throw light on the cause of death. A complete examination of the cardiovascular system could have shown the cause of death.
